Analysis

The most recent figure for manure applied to soils — emissions (co2eq) from n2o in Morocco is 289.88 kt, measured in 2050. That is the highest value across all 65 years on record.

Over the whole period, manure applied to soils — emissions (co2eq) from n2o in Morocco peaked at 289.88 kt in 2050 and was at its lowest, 67.92 kt, in 1963.

Morocco ranks 80th of 195 countries on this measure, in the middle of the range.

The long-run direction has been consistently rising across the 65 years of available data.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
